
Astero Styliani Lamprinou originally from Athens and based in Brussels, studied movement, dance, cultural theory and choreography, at the Laban Center and the London Contemporary Dance School and completed a masters in Surrey University with a scholarship from A. Onassis foundation. She has worked predominantly as a performer in various fields (contemporary dance, opera, theater, video, installation) in London, Ireland, Athens and Brussels. She has worked with Dance Theater of Ireland, English National Opera, English National Theater and with choreographers such as Yolande Snaith and David Hernandez.
Astero sees dance as living architecture and is very preoccupied with visual matters. She is therefore very relieved to have been able to cross over to the audiovisual field. Her first short dance film is ‘Secret City’, a dancing passage in the city of Brussels with a comparison of the city in the early 1900s and today, and her second is ‘Wall to Wall’, a site-specific dance film, both completed in October 2020.
